I Paid Off My Husband’s Debt and Later Found Out He Made It All Up Just to Take My Money – He Deeply Regretted It

When Mike claimed he owed his boss $8,000 for wrecking a car, I didn’t hesitate. I dipped into the inheritance my grandmother left me and handed him the money, believing I was saving his job — saving us. But a stray file on his laptop exposed the truth: there was no wrecked car, no angry boss. Instead, he’d booked an $8K Miami getaway with our married neighbor, Sarah.

The lies unraveled quickly. His boss had never heard of any accident. His “business trip” was a cover story. And while I played the dutiful wife, he was planning his escape with her. So I set a quiet trap — a dinner with Sarah and her unsuspecting husband — and let the truth crash into them all at once.

The next morning, I walked out. No yelling, no second chances. Just silence, a packed bag, and divorce papers filed while he was on his so-called trip.

By the time karma finished with him — job gone, health failing, Sarah back with her husband — I had already built a new life. Small apartment, creaky wooden floors, photography classes, and freedom.

Because trust, once shattered, doesn’t need fixing. Sometimes the cleanest cut is walking away.
